WebFeb 14, 2024 · How to Plant Cauliflower Sow seeds in rows 3 to 6 inches apart and up to ½ inch deep. Set plants 18 to 24 inches apart with 30 inches between rows. In early spring, be ready to protect plants from frost by covering them with old milk jugs, if necessary. Extreme cold can halt growth and/or form buttons. first community bank harlingen https://sptcpa.com

WebDig up forcing chicory plants in November, discarding any that are less than 2.5cm (1in) across at the crown. Cut back the old leaves to 2.5cm (1in) above the crown. Force a few roots at a time by planting up to five vertically in a 25cm (10in) pot of moist compost, leaving the crown exposed at the surface. Your number one resource for all that can go wrong with … WebBeetroots can also be sown in large containers, at least 40cm (16in) wide, filled with multi-purpose compost. Choose varieties with rounded roots, rather than long deep ones. Sow the seeds 10cm (4in) apart, then cover with about 2.5cm (1in) of compost. Water gently to avoid disturbing the seeds.
